Pica has assisted customers with their activated carbon needs since the 1950s, offering specialised products to the market with a strong focus on products manufactured from coconut shell and wood raw materials.
The combination of Jacobi and Pica should create a leading supplier of activated carbon products and solutions, with close to 1,000 employees worldwide.
The company will be the world’s largest coconut shell carbon manufacturer, with wholly owned production assets in three countries (India, Sri Lanka and Vietnam) and a combined coconut shell carbon capacity in excess of 88m lbs.
In Europe, Jacobi will offer reactivation and mobile filter service with two centres (Vierzon, France and Premnitz, Germany) and the production in France will add highly specialised wood based products to the portfolio.
The supply of coal based carbons from Jacobi China will be significantly expanded to complement the needs of the combined entity.
